Resumo

This article aims to discuss one of George Bataille thoughts, from the analysis of the erotic novel Story of the eye, one of his most outstanding works. The History of the eye is filled with narrative scenes where the image of the eye is seen as a transfiguravel object. In this book, Bataille argues heterogeneous when discussing topics such as eroticism and sacred, addressed a vision that opposes the discourse of a bourgeois society that preaches what is homogeneous, showing from the erotic scenes confrontation to “normality” of the society of the time, with the presentation of situations to a certain surreal point, endowed with transgression. Thus, the discussion points out that the work of Bataille seeks to repudiate the issues taken for granted essentially on eroticism and sexuality, as the latter is stated as unproductive expenditure, overspending and completely sterile, because sex is not presented as source of relief or satiety but as a great distress. A milestone that distinguishes the work is the relationship between sexuality, sacred and eroticism, going beyond simple sexual adventure, for the pursuit of “orgasm” through the eye imagery. To discuss these issues, the ideas presented here are backed up in the following authors: George Bataille, Barthes, Wasghinton Drumonnd, Jurgen Habermas, Philippe Joron, Michel Leiris and Eliane Moraes.
